Job Description
The Volunteers of America Colorado Float Team is a team of experienced professionals that assist in the facilities that we serve, such as the Senior Community Care Program for All-Inclusive Care for the Elderly (PACE), Horizons Health Care Center, Valley Manor Care Center, the Homestead at Montrose, and Home Health of Western Colorado.
As a PRN Licensed Practical Nurse, you will enjoy ultimate flexibility and work as little as 4 shifts per month or full time hours, it is YOUR choice.
One (1) year of experience is required - you will be expected to work at any VOA facility that has a need.
The Licensed Practical Nurse shall perform in accordance with state and local laws and within the guidelines of his/her professional organization. All functions shall be performed in accordance with the established policies and practices of Agency and the particular institution in which the LPN is performing his/her duties. The LPN is qualified by education, training, experience and demonstrated abilities to give nursing care under the direction of a RN and to have the knowledge of the principles of psychological, biological and social sciences.

Job Requirements
QUALIFICATIONS:
1. Graduate from an accredited school of nursing with current licensure as a Licensed Practical Nurse in Colorado
2. Effective communicator with staff, families and outside agencies.
3. Ability to prioritize duties.
4. Customer service oriented with knowledge of successful customer service techniques.
5. Ability to understand residents' charts, doctor's orders, residents' plan of care, medication orders.
6. Must posses the ability to effectively gather clinical data in regards to resident status and condition.
7. Ability to utilize computers and other electronic devices for tasks such as timekeeping, in-servicing and documentation.
8. Must be willing to work in facilities following infection control precautions and regular testing for COVID-19
